saleably
/ˈseɪləbli/Definitions
1. adverb
In a saleable manner; in a way that is capable of being sold profitably.
“The new product was launched saleably, with a strong marketing campaign and attractive pricing.”
2. adverb
In a manner that is capable of being sold; in a way that is attractive to buyers.
“The company’s products were sold saleably, with a focus on quality and customer service.”
